    We stopped into Harlow's for a special event and I really didn't know what to expect, but was pleasantly surprised by the space. They checked IDs at the door and our tickets for the event were scanned as we walked in. We were there early and it was pretty spacious with limited seating for the amount of people at the event we were attending. We made our way to the bar and ordered some drinks. The drinks seemed to range from $8-$15 and most of the drinks we ordered were $14. They also offer some food options which is nice! They utilized the stage for the event we attended and the audio, lighting and event were well done. They also have a back, outdoor, area that was decorated for Halloween and was a nice area to get a bit more personal space and fresh air. They had multiple bathrooms available, but I didn't use the facilities during this visit. After visiting, I would definitely come back again, but maybe come even earlier or buy the premium tickets to snag a seat instead of standing the whole time.

    Expanding Into Fun DJ-Dance Events More! SITREP I've always enjoyed Harlow's a swanky speakeasy dinner theatre that hosts some really sweet bands. But I love seeing more of the kind of DJ-Dance events that l like to participate in. Usually the fun Gothic-Industrial events I like to patronize have been relegated to the Starlet Lounge ABOVE Harlow's on the 2nd Floor. Starlet is a great venue in itself, but much much smaller, with considerably less square footage for it's dancefloor. CHANGE-OF-HEART Now apparently the management have had a change of heart and realize that not only is it good business for them, but it's great for the loyal Gothic-Industrial scene to *open up* the larger Harlow's venue dancefloor to this loyal dance scene. THE SETUP Harlow's dancefloor is a nice large expansive floor that has tables and booth around the perimeter. There is a large expansive bar that is located on the right hand side as soon as you enter the venue. Makes it quite convenient to grab a drink, and then go and peruse the rest of the venue. HUGE PATIO! The patio is (almost) a venue in and of itself! Both lawned and hard surfaced-pathed, there are times when there is a DJ spinning out back here with some pretty chill music to relax to, or even host their own dance patio here! Very cool artistic media is thrown up onto the high walls and on some nights, the patio - which is accessible directly from Harlow's and by the staircase leading up & down from the Starlet Lounge - can be quite the multi-venue event space which can be accessed and intermixed by both venues at the same time.     Can tickets be purchased at the venue or only via etix?

    Tickets can be purchased at the venue M-F 10-5. Call ahead on holidays to make sure we are open.

    Has anyone attended their Mardi Gras event? Is food available for purchase?

    Hi Abby, our kitchen will be open!

    Are 16 year olds allowed to attend a show with a parent accompanying them?

    Hi Monique! If the show is marked as "All Ages," guests of any age are welcome to attend. Age restrictions are specified on the show's page on our website. If you have any questions regarding any specific show, please give our office a call!
